Kraft offers a DDR-style game and $10 pad

Kraft is offering a "free" game pad (with a $9.99 shipping & handling fee) so folks can try out 2 free steppin' games on their PCs.
The quality of the mat's probably nothing to replace your metal arcade set-up with, but the Groove Master and Rockin' the Boat games you can download for it are free. (And you can likely use the USB pad for better PC dance games as well if Kraft's downloads don't float your boat; an online demo for Rockin' the Boat can be found here.)
Promoting an active lifestyle seems in line with corporate packaged-food and junk/fast-food strategies these days, especially if potential lawsuits are to be headed off at the pass.
